Carrier For Containers

A carrier for holding multiple containers may include an upper carrier portion having several carrier sections. Each carrier section may include an attachment panel that at least partially defines multiple container openings for at least partially receiving respective containers and may include container retention tabs foldably connected to the attachment panel and extending into the container openings for at least partially engaging the containers. A handle panel may be foldably connected to each attachment panel. The carrier may further include a lower tray portion having panels that extend at least partially around an interior of the lower tray portion, including a bottom panel, at least one end panel, and at least one side panel. The interior of the lower tray portion may at least partially receive the containers, and each carrier section may be separably connected to at least one side panel of the lower tray portion.

CONTAINER CARRIER

A container carrier for unitizing a plurality of containers including a plurality of outer bands and inner bands forming an array of container receiving apertures arranged in two or more transverse pairs. Each outer band of the plurality of outer bands forms a convex container engaging portion of each container receiving aperture. A central grasping aperture is positioned between each transverse pair of container receiving apertures and includes opposite radiused ends and a central expanded opening. A stress relief cutout is positioned along each inner band between each container receiving aperture and each central grasping aperture.

MULTIPLE BOTTLE CARRIER
20260125192 · 2026-05-07 ·

A multiple bottle carrier of cardboard or the like cellulosic material has a center portion and two lateral portions which are orthogonally arranged with respect to the center portion and originate from a basis of the center portion. Each lateral portion has one or more holes, each of which is surrounded by a crown of adjacent separate tabs, whose folding upwards permits insertion of a neck of a respective bottle that is prevented from coming out of the hole. Each lateral portion has a longitudinal folding line which is intermediate between the basis of the center portion and a distal side of the lateral portion. A median aperture has an upper portion extending through the center portion and lower portions extending through a proximal part of each lateral portion. The upper portion of the median aperture allows insertion of hand fingers of a user.
